Thulium-doped all-fiber laser mode-locked by CVD-graphene/PMMA saturable absorber.

Grzegorz Sobon1, Jaroslaw Sotor, Iwona Pasternak, Aleksandra Krajewska, Wlodek Strupinski, Krzysztof M Abramski.   

Abstract

We report an all-fiber Tm-doped fiber laser mode-locked by graphene saturable absorber. The laser emits 1.2 ps pulses at 1884 nm center wavelength with 4 nm of bandwidth and 20.5 MHz mode spacing. The graphene layers were grown on copper foils by chemical vapor deposition (CVD) and transferred onto the fiber connector end. Up to date this is the shortest reported pulse duration achieved from a Tm-doped laser mode-locked by graphene saturable absorber. Such cost-effective and stable fiber lasers might be considered as sources for mid-infrared spectroscopy and remote sensing.
